Defensive Pass Interference
 
Just had a thought, and I don't know how to mark it off.

2nd and 10 from the 50. A's pass from A18 to A83 is completed at the 30 yard line where he is tackeld by B24. While the ball was in the air B24 used his arms to pull down one of A83's arm. The penality for DPI is enforced from the 30, to make it 1st and 10 from the 15...correct?

JRutledge Mon Sep 17, 2007 10:52am

DPI is a previous spot foul (it is a loose ball play by definition. So in your scenario it is likely they will decline the penalty.
